Software Engineering Specialist

2 weeks ago


Cape Town, Western Cape, South Africa Network Recruitment Full time

We are seeking an experienced Software Engineering Specialist to join our team at Network Recruitment. This is a highly rewarding opportunity to work on complex software solutions, leveraging your skills in Java development.

About the Role

As a key member of our team, you will be responsible for designing, developing, and implementing robust software solutions that meet our business needs.

This role offers a unique chance to grow with our company and contribute to the success of our clients.

Job Requirements

To succeed in this position, you will need:

  • At least 5 years of experience in Java development
  • Tertiary qualification (advantageous)
  • Proficiency in Spring, Hibernate, and SQL
  • Experience with RESTful APIs and microservices architecture

In return, we offer a competitive salary package and the opportunity to work on challenging projects.

What We Offer

Our team is committed to delivering high-quality results, and we strive to maintain a positive and supportive work environment.

We estimate the salary for this role to be around $120,000 per year, depending on location and experience.



  • Cape Town, Western Cape, South Africa MRI Software Full time

    Property Management X Support RoleMRI Software, a global industry leader in real estate software, seeks a skilled Software Support Specialist to join our team in Cape Town, South Africa. This exciting opportunity offers the chance to work with cutting-edge technology and collaborate with a talented group of professionals.


  • Cape Town, Western Cape, South Africa MRI Software Full time

    About the RoleAt MRI Software, we're on a mission to break new ground and lead the real estate industry into a digital-first future. As a Software Support Specialist, you'll play a crucial role in helping us achieve this goal.Key ResponsibilitiesDevelop a deep understanding of the Occupier product suite, including its functional and technical...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    About the Role:MRI Software is seeking a skilled Software Engineer to join our team in Cape Town. As a key member of our software development team, you will be responsible for designing, developing, testing, and maintaining software solutions throughout the software development lifecycle.Key Responsibilities:Develop software features in a self-sufficient way...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    About This RoleWe're expanding our team at MRI Software, a global leader in real estate software, and looking for a talented Software Implementation Specialist to join our ranks!This is an exciting opportunity to work with our cutting-edge software solutions, helping clients achieve their goals in the affordable housing sector.As a Software Implementation...

  • Software Engineer

    4 weeks ago


    Cape Town, Western Cape, South Africa Mainline Civil Engineering Contractors Full time

    We are looking for a skilled Software Engineer to join our team at {company}. As a key member of our development team, you will design and develop high-quality software solutions that meet the needs of our customers. Key responsibilities include analyzing business requirements, developing software specifications, and collaborating with cross-functional teams...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    About the JobWe are seeking a highly skilled Intermediate Mobile Software Engineer to join our dynamic team at Entelect.Delivery: As an Intermediate Mobile Software Engineer, you will be responsible for developing world-class mobile applications for leading organizations in South Africa.People: You will work closely with cross-functional teams to tackle...


  • Cape Town, Western Cape, South Africa Spinnaker Software Full time

    Job DescriptionWe are seeking a detail-oriented Software Quality Assurance Specialist to join our team at Spinnaker Software.This role involves playing a vital part in ensuring the high quality of our software products. As a QA Analyst, your primary responsibility will be to identify and report bugs, defects, and areas for improvement in our applications.You...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    Job Title: QA EngineerAt MRI Software, we're on a mission to break new ground and lead the real estate industry into a digital-first future. As a QA Engineer, you'll play a critical role in ensuring our products and services meet the highest standards of quality.Responsibilities:Develop and execute automated test strategies, leveraging industry best...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Lead a team of talented software engineers at Entelect, where innovation meets expertise. We are seeking an experienced Software Engineering Lead to drive our delivery teams towards exceptional results.We prioritize growth, collaboration, and innovation in our culture, offering a dynamic environment that fosters versatility and individual attention to career...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    Role Description:About the Role:We are seeking an experienced Java Software Engineer to join our dynamic team at Entelect Software Ltd. As a key member of our team, you will be responsible for delivering high-quality software solutions that meet the needs of our clients.Key Responsibilities:Design, develop, and test software applications using...


  • Cape Town, Western Cape, South Africa Planet10 Full time

    Job OverviewPlanet10 is seeking an experienced Software Engineering Specialist to join our team. This role involves working on code enhancements, updating the code repository, and delivering and updating API repositories.


  • Cape Town, Western Cape, South Africa MRI Software Full time

    MRI Software is a leading provider of real estate software solutions, with a mission to improve people's lives through flexible and game-changing technology. We are seeking a talented Quality Assurance Specialist to join our team and contribute to the success of our customers.We offer a unique opportunity to work in a dynamic and fast-paced environment,...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    About the RoleWe are seeking an experienced Mobile Software Engineer to join our team at Entelect. As a key member of our software development team, you will be responsible for designing, developing, and delivering high-quality mobile applications for our clients.Your Key ResponsibilitiesYou will work closely with cross-functional teams to identify, scope,...


  • Cape Town, Western Cape, South Africa Entelect Software Ltd Full time

    About This Role: Entelect Software Ltd is looking for a skilled Software Engineer to drive the development of world-class web and mobile applications for leading organisations in South Africa. As an Intermediate Java Software Engineer, you will play a key role in enhancing product quality through containerisation and continuous integration, fostering a...


  • Cape Town, Western Cape, South Africa JenRec Recruitment Full time

    Software Development OpportunitiesAt JenRec Recruitment, we're looking for talented Software Engineers to join our team in Cape Town. As a Software Engineering Specialist, you will be responsible for designing, developing, testing, and deploying software solutions using agile methodologies. Our team uses a variety of technologies, including .Net, MVC, SQL...


  • Cape Town, Western Cape, South Africa MSP Staffing LTD Full time

    Our client, MSP Staffing LTD, is seeking an experienced Software Engineering Specialist to join their team in Cape Town. This full-time position offers a unique opportunity for an expert to make a significant impact with their expertise.Key Requirements5 years experience overallBSc/ BTech/ N.DipPower BI (Fabric)C#MSSQLJavaScriptPlease email your CV to...


  • Cape Town, Western Cape, South Africa MSP Staffing LTD Full time

    Company OverviewMSP Staffing LTD is a dynamic and innovative company that prides itself on delivering exceptional staffing solutions to its clients. Our team of experts works tirelessly to understand the needs of our clients and provide tailored solutions that meet their expectations.Job DescriptionWe are seeking a highly skilled Software Engineering...


  • Cape Town, Western Cape, South Africa BOSS Consult Full time

    About the Role:The Software Engineering Specialist will be responsible for designing and implementing application solutions that meet the needs of BOSS Consult. Key responsibilities include constructing and testing programs using modern development tools and cloud services, ensuring high-quality code and documentation, and integrating front-end with backend...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    At MRI Software, we're on a mission to revolutionize the real estate industry with cutting-edge technology. As a Software Engineer, you'll play a crucial role in developing innovative software solutions that drive client success.Key Responsibilities:Design and develop software features that meet the highest technical standardsCollaborate with...


  • Cape Town, Western Cape, South Africa MRI Software Full time

    About the RoleMRI Software is seeking a highly skilled Software Support Analyst to join our team in Cape Town, South Africa. As a key member of our support team, you will be responsible for resolving customer queries and analyzing software issues to recommend solutions.Key ResponsibilitiesDevelop a deep understanding of the Property Management X product...